Vivek Oberoi

Vivek Oberoi had created stirs with his role as Chadu in ‘Company’. After a long gap of seven years, RGV has again taken up the task of proving the actor’s worth by casting him in the lead role of rebel-turned politician Paritala Ravi in his ambitious venture ‘Rakta Charitra’ and says the film will re-launch both of them in Bollywood.“After thinking hard on every actor both known and unknown, I finally zeroed in on Vivek Oberoi as the most ideal choice to play Paritala Ravi,” Varma, who has almost finished the shoot of Agyaat and is busy wrapping up Rann, said.

Ramu expresses his trust in Vivek stating, “For me, Vivek is the perfect choice for the role. Also, I know for sure that no way can Vivek get a better role than that of Paritala Ravi and no way can I get a better story than ‘Rakta Charitra’ to be told. This is why the film would be re-launching both of us.” he added.

“He has remarkable intensity in his eyes which I noticed during the making of ‘Company’. He has a voice which commands attention, there is an arrogance in his demeanour and an enormous power in his stance. Moreover, there is also a certain vulnerability, which makes one instantly warm up to him, which is what is needed to fit into Paritala Ravi’s profile,” the director explained.

The story of Rakta Charitra will span 12-15 years during which Vivek would be seen in different looks- From being a rebel in the jungles to a political strongman.

Bobby Deol plays a hired killer



Bobby Deol plays a hired killer in his latest "Ek - The Power of One", nine years after he played a similar role in "Bichhoo". The actor says he has no problem playing a negative role again.

"There were no apprehensions. Actors who play romantic heroes in most of the films don't get apprehensive before taking another such project; so why should I?" he said.

Directed by Sangeeth Sivan, "Ek" is a remake of Telugu film "Athadu" and also stars southern star Shriya Saran.

"Though I also did such a role in 'Bichhoo', this one is a far more stylised version of a professional killer. In fact I was very excited when I saw the southern version of 'Ek' and said yes to the role," Bobby told IANS over phone from Mumbai.

Known for his action image, the 39-year-old said that the action sequences in the film were something to look out for.

"The USP of the film is its action. It has been shot and choreographed very well and it will offer amazing action sequences to all action fans in the country. They'll love it," he said.

Bobby shrugged off media rumours that he jumped of the 14th floor for the film.

"My jump has been exaggerated in the media. I jumped only from the seventh floor, not 14th - though that was also scary enough," he laughed.

Bobby, who was last seen in "Dostana" with short cropped hair, was excited about his new look in "Ek".

"I sport a straightened hair look in the film. It's ironic that my hair has been straightened despite my constant advice to people that one should not get them straightened at all as it spoils your hair," the actor said.

The film has Nana Patekar playing a Central Bureau of Investigation (CBI) inspector and Bobby is all praise for the 58-year-old's energy levels.

"Nana is a great guy. He is so agile and active. In fact, for his age, he is so fit and I really admire him for that," he said.

Apparently Nana almost always surprised the unit members with his energetic sprints and his rigorous gym sessions.

But Bobby too is known for his fit physique. What's the secret behind that?

"As far as my physical regime is concerned, I just do my usual workout including a bit of cardio. I don't work very specifically on my body for any one film," the actor said.

Asked if he also planned to venture into direction like his elder brother Sunny, he said: "I don't know. I can't foresee the future. It's a dream of every actor to direct a film some day, but who knows."

Bobby's future projects include "Cheers - Celebrate Life", "Roshan", "Formula No.44" and "Gangs of London".

Shah Rukh Khan's smoking act



Bollywood superstar Shah Rukh Khan's smoking act during an Indian Premier League (IPL) match April 21 has not gone down well with the anti-smoking lobby which is trying to ensure that television footage of celebrities smoking should not be broadcast.The National Organisation for Tobacco Eradication (NOTE) said in a statement issued here Saturday that its counterpart South African National Council Against Smoking (NCAS) is lobbying with the official broadcasters to ensure that footage of smoking, especially by celebrities, should not be broadcast.

"We have sent the details to Supersport, who are the official broadcasters of the IPL and the NCAS is in the process of soliciting an agreement that they will not show anyone smoking," NCAS's convener Peter Ucko informed NOTE Friday.NCAS has said that television footage showing icons smoking dangerously increases the chances of children and other non smokers picking up the habit as they try to emulate their heroes.

NCAS, in its letter to NOTE, further said that while smoking in public places is still not banned in South Africa, the department of health there was very active in lobbying for the concept of no smoking in public places.

"If Khan does it again we will ask the management to caution him, or we will seek his removal from the stadium," the press note states.The NCAS has also assured that they would lobby with the chief executive officer of the Wandereres stadium Alam Kourie to enforce the 'no smoking in enclosed areas' law.

"We have also asked the stadium management to make no smoking announcements through the match and during drinks breaks."

Rakhi Sawant





















Rakhi Sawant is all set to get married? But she does not have a groom picked out yet. The item girl of Indian cinema will be starting in NDTV Imagine's new reality TV show called Rakhi Ka Swayamvara in which with the help from the viewer she will pick the perfect man to marry. Rakhi was also on reality show Bigg Boss 2 , and was in the spotlight for all the wrong reasons. The format of the show is very similar to the American show The Bachelorette. During the show, 15 grooms of her choice will be brought together under one roof along with her, and will have to go thru a series of challenges that will test their personality, character, physical fitness, talent and their compatibility with Rakhi.
